The APA-165 family is ElectroAir's highest-capacity diesel GPU platform, designed for heavy-duty apron work involving wide-body commercial fleets, military transports, or simultaneous servicing of two aircraft. Its defining feature is dual 400 Hz AC output — each channel rated at up to 180 kVA — with optional single or dual 28.5 VDC channels rated at 800 A continuous (overload to 2,000 A for two seconds). This combination allows a single unit to power an aircraft's AC systems while simultaneously supporting DC-dependent avionics or engine-start circuits. The towable APA-165 rides on a NATO D40/F towing eye chassis with solid tubeless wheels, an integrated parking brake, and a beacon-lit composite enclosure (IP55). A Perkins or Deutz engine with water-cooled closed-circuit cooling powers the unit; the fuel tank covers more than eight hours at full load. Converter efficiency is approximately 97% and power factor exceeds 0.8 at full load. The APA-165E variant mounts on an IVECO NEXT 4×2 truck chassis and adds 24/48 V engine-start capability via dedicated SHRAP-250M connectors — extending its utility to older or specialised military types requiring high-current DC starts. Error log storage via USB, MIL/CIV interlock mode, EMC filters, and automatic line-drop compensation are standard across all variants. For procurement teams at busy international hubs or military air wings with mixed AC/DC demand, the APA-165 eliminates the need for separate GPU and starting unit assets at each stand.

Technical specifications.

Performance & capability
DC Peak Overload2,000 A for 2 s
24/48 V Start (APA-165E)Up to 500 / 1,200 A for 2 min
Converter Efficiency≈97 %
THD (AC)≤3 %
Fuel Autonomy>8 hours at 100% load
Engine OptionsPerkins or Deutz, electric start
Interfaces & integration
AC OutputUp to 2×180 kVA, 3×115/200 VAC, 400 Hz
DC OutputUp to 2×28.5 VDC / 800 A continuous
Power & environment
Power Factor>0.8 at 100% load
Enclosure ProtectionIP55 (APA-165), IP54 converter block (APA-165E)
Operating Temperature-20 to +55°C (APA-165E: -40 to +50°C)
Physical & ordering
Dimensions (towable)3,700×1,700×1,850 mm, <3,000–3,400 kg
